MySQLdowsuxacOS。在MySQL中,刷新是一个重要的操作,可以帮助我们在数据库中更新或重置数据。本文将详细介绍MySQL刷新的含义和使用方法。
一、MySQL刷新的含义
MySQL刷新是指将当前数据库的缓存刷新到磁盘中,以确保数据的一致性和完整性。当我们对数据库进行修改时,MySQL会将这些修改保存在缓存中,而不是立即写入磁盘。这样可以提高数据库的性能和响应速度。但是,如果数据库崩溃或意外关闭,未写入磁盘的数据将会丢失。因此,我们需要定期刷新数据库的缓存,以确保所有的修改都已经写入磁盘中。
二、MySQL刷新的使用方法
MySQL刷新有多种方法,下面我们将介绍其中两种常用的方法。
1. 使用FLUSH命令
FLUSH命令是MySQL中一个常用的命令,它可以用来刷新数据库的缓存。FLUSH命令有多种选项,其中包括:
- FLUSH TABLES:刷新所有表的缓存。
- FLUSH PRIVILEGES:重新加载权限表。
- FLUSH LOGS:关闭并重新打开所有日志文件。
- FLUSH HOSTS:清除所有主机名缓存。
我们可以根据需要选择合适的选项来刷新数据库的缓存。例如,如果我们想刷新所有表的缓存,可以使用以下命令:
FLUSH TABLES;
ysqladmin命令
ysqladminysqladmin命令也可以用来刷新数据库的缓存。